It looks like the annual Western Port Whiting Challenge 2018 may be the last.

The following is an extract from this months news letter from the Western Port Angling club.

"PRESIDENTS REPORT - Bob Wilkinson
Hello to all the Members,
As you all should know by now, The Whing Challenge last year only earned us $1000.00 Profit.
As this small profit was earned by the wonderful efforts of so very few club members, it has been decided
that the 2018 Challenge could be out last unless many more people come on board to help."
